site stats

Libc static linking

WebWhen using any of the threaded mpms in Apache 2.0 it is important that every function called from Apache be thread safe. When linking in 3rd party extensions it can be difficult to determine whether the resulting server will be thread safe. Casual testing generally won't tell you this either as thread safety problems can lead to subtle race ... WebThese common functions in util could be built as a library that each programmer could link as a static library (lib.a) or better built as a shared object (lib.so) that is dyanmically shared. ... ‘libc.a’, is automatically linked into your programs by the “gcc” compiler and can be found at /usr/lib/libc.a. Standard system libraries are ...

How to link to libc statically? - CodeProject

Websibylfs 0.5.0 (latest): formal specification and oracle-based testing for POSIX file systems Web(对我而言)不是很清楚为什么限制 (libm.a + libc.so) 是必要的,所以它闻起来像一个 XY 问题.根据 [RedHat.Bugzilla]: Bug 1433347 - glibc: Selective static linking of libm.a fails due to unresolved _dl_x86_cpu_features symbol (@KamilCuk 指出):. This is not supported. You would be mixing a static libm.a with future libc.so.6 and ld.so and that breaks the ... shipston on stour recycling https://jpmfa.com

Why is statically linking glibc discouraged? - Stack Overflow

Web17. sep 2024. · 1 Like. vmedea September 18, 2024, 7:52am #2. it should be possible (might be just a matter of passing -static to the linker), though statically linking with glibc … Web6,314 followers. 4h. Several customers already use our AAI Scenario Cloning & Extraction tool-chain to get the maps, incl. map-connected objects, and maneuvers (trajectories) from their real-world ... http://www.musl-libc.org/how.html shipston on stour railway

Why is statically linking glibc discouraged? - Stack Overflow

Category:Build a Statically Linked or Mostly-Statically Linked Native

Tags:Libc static linking

Libc static linking

compiling - How can I get glibc as a static library? - Ask Ubuntu

Web13. avg 2024. · 3 Answers. The reasons given in other answers are correct, but they are not the most important reason. The most important reason why glibc should not be statically … Web23. dec 2024. · 4. I'm answering my own question here for those who naively came here searching on keywords like static link libc or something. If this is for MSVC, your only option is /MT or /MTd. But if you came here looking for GCC, welcome to the position …

Libc static linking

Did you know?

WebWith GraalVM Native Image you can build a mostly-static native executable that statically links everything except libc. Statically linking all your libraries except libc ensures your application has all the libraries it needs to run on any Linux libc-based distribution. To build a mostly-static native executable, use this command: Web18. sep 2024. · That said, you can choose to statically link C and C++ programs on Linux, only when you know what you are doing and why.And you have ways to avoid some …

Web12. mar 2024. · The project is using autotools. I am using the default gcc preinstalled with Ubuntu. I set CFLAGS with export CFLAGS="-static -static-libgcc". I am compiling the … Webimaplet-lwt 0.1.15 (latest): IMAP server prototype, supports IMAPv4rev1

WebStatic linking additional P/Invoke libraries. When building applications, in some cases, NuGet provided libraries may use native dependencies that are emscripten provided libraries, such as libc. In such cases, the boostrapper allows for providing a set of known P/Invoke libraries as follows:

WebC++ : how to static link with clang libc++To Access My Live Chat Page, On Google, Search for "hows tech developer connect"I promised to share a hidden featur...

Web14. dec 2024. · That will be because you do not have a static libc++ (i.e. libc++.a) installed on your system.Archlinux defaulted to not installing static libraries 5 years ago, so it will … quickbooks payroll employee set upWebThis file must be specified for static linking. The routines that it names are imported automatically by libc.a for dynamic linking, so you do not need to specify this file during … quickbooks payroll check printingWeb10. okt 2015. · 11. You should #include "libstatic.h", i.e. use the appropriate header file in your code ( that's why your code doesn't compile) and include the path to your libstatic.a … shipston-on-stour recyclingWebIn the example below, two lines are marked "COMMENT ME OUT": one in hello_c/main.cpp and the other in hello_c/CMakeLists.txt. If you comment these out, the reference to the hello_lib library is removed; the project builds and the executable executes on Windows 10 without a libstdc++ dependency. If you uncomment the two lines, the function in ... quickbooks payroll enhanced vs basicWeb02. feb 2024. · libc++ is available as both a static and shared library. Warning: Using static runtimes can cause unexpected behavior. See the static runtimes section for more information.. libc++. LLVM's libc++ is the C++ standard library that has been used by the Android OS since Lollipop, and as of NDK r18 is the only STL available in the NDK.. … shipston on stour refuse centreWeb04. jun 2024. · I build the code with clang 5.0 with: clang++ testcoroutine.cpp -std =c++2a -I .. /asio_alone -fcoroutines-ts -stdlib =libc++. Copy. The code works fine. Now I want to … shipston on stour neighbourhood planWebSolid is a device integration framework. It provides a way of querying and interacting with hardware independently of the underlying operating system. shipston on stour pubs and restaurants